Best Wishes, . only be used casually or informally as it doesn’t have a . Historically, with best regards and with kindest regards have been used as a letter closing—a.k.a. a valediction. In decades past, regards implied not only esteem but also affection; today it sits somewhat higher on the spectrum of formality. So, best regards means with my best wishes and esteem, or something to that effect.A common, semi-formal valediction used to at the end of a letter or other written message to express well wishes to the recipient.
